如何在documentready上隐藏div,然后从Javascript动态调用它?

如何在documentready上隐藏div,然后从Javascript动态调用它?,javascript,jquery,Javascript,Jquery,我使用这段代码来隐藏一个动态放置文本的div容器 $(document).ready(function(){ $(".slidingDiv").hide(); $(".show_hide").show(); $('.show_hide').click(function(){ $(".slidingDiv").slideToggle(); }); }); 我遇到的问题是,我想从javascript函数而不是预定义的单击事件触发sho

我使用这段代码来隐藏一个动态放置文本的div容器

$(document).ready(function(){
     $(".slidingDiv").hide(); 
     $(".show_hide").show();

     $('.show_hide').click(function(){
         $(".slidingDiv").slideToggle();
     });
 });
我遇到的问题是,我想从javascript函数而不是预定义的单击事件触发show
div
。我已经找到了这个匹配我想要的函数的示例,但是我不确定如何从javascript而不是单击函数触发它


只需使用css隐藏div即可

display:none;

.slidingDiv{
 display:none;
}
当你想用的时候就展示出来

.show()

$(".slidingDiv").show();
编辑:

在编辑问题之后,始终可以通过编程方式触发单击事件,如

function yourFunction(){
  $(".show_hide").click();
} 

在脚本中的任何时候,都可以使用
div
的id/class调用
jQuery
对象,并运行
show()
函数。i、 e

var javascript = "cool";
var foo = "I'm doing stuff";
var bar = "And some more stuff";
if (javascript === "cool") 
    jQuery(".slidingDiv").show();
else 
    $(".slidingDiv").show();

$(文档).ready(函数(){
$(“input[type='file']”)。在(“change”上,函数(){
如果(this.files[0].size>1000000)//文件大小小于1MB{
{
$(“#fileAlert”).show();//调用引导4警报
}
$(this.val(“”);
}
});
});

set timeout和setTimeinterval是一个函数,允许在它中设置的某个周期性时间后调用函数。您可以修改JSFIDLE来说明这一点吗?这不包括幻灯片打开。我想是因为css元素。你目前的解决方案有什么问题?在显示和隐藏元素的同时,你能用小提琴来解释你所面临的问题吗?你能给你的答案添加一些解释吗?